Jaedyn Shaw is making waves in the football league with her impressive debut for Gotham FC, scoring a crucial goal that helped her team secure a 2-0 victory over San Diego Wave, propelling them into a third-place tie with San Diego FC. This significant win not only showcases Shaw's talents but also highlights the team's determination and skill, setting them apart in the competitive landscape of women's football.
